We define experiments to measure viewer comfort and 3D fusion as a function of 3D depth shift. We analyze the subjective results and find relation between the subjective results and psychovisual models. We relate subjects' viewer comfort with Percival's zone of comfort and subjects' fusion limit with Panum's fusion area.
